Our special meeting guest:

Doug Grindstaff

Topic: The CMMI Cyber maturity model and its applications

Bio
E. Doug Grindstaff II is Senior Vice President of Cybersecurity Solutions at CMMI Institute.  A visionary leader and product evangelist who has held several senior executive and Board positions in the technology and biotech industries, Doug leads the commercialization and go-to-market strategy for the CMMI Cybermaturity platform.  He has previously served as CEO of NuSirt Sciences, CEO-in-Residence for Carnegie Innovations Portfolio and President of the Invisible Fence brand. Prior to that, he served as Chairman and President of Bioganic Biopesticide, where he oversaw the rapid expansion and the acquisition by a well-known consumer brands company. Grindstaff also served as an executive for a number of private and public consumer brand companies, including Kraft Foods, Inc.

Doug’s team helped to author and expand use of many recognized business and security frameworks such as the National Institutes of Standards and Technology (NIST) Cybersecurity Framework, the NICE Workforce Framework, ISACA's COBIT, the CMMI Cybermaturity Platform, ISACA’s guide for implementing the NIST Cybersecurity Framework, and the Baldrige Cybersecurity Excellence Builder as well as a core membership of the team to create the Cybersecurity Framework to Secure Critical Infrastructure, a publication developed by NIST and the public in response to Presidential Executive Order 13636 to provide a common language for communicating, assessing, and reporting cybersecurity risk management objectives.
